Dealerships
Car key fobs have become an integral element of modern cars that provide convenience and security to drivers. They can lock or unlock a car, set the security alarm of the vehicle and even turn on the car if the correct key to turn the ignition is used. If these devices are damaged or destroyed, they must be replaced or reprogrammed to ensure that they function as intended. Many people are shocked to learn that the cost of reprogramming these devices could be very costly, especially when the service is offered by an auto dealer. Understanding the costs involved can aid you in deciding whether you should go to a dealer or an auto locksmith to get this service.
The kind of car key that you own will have a major impact on the amount it will cost to modify the device. There are several different types of key fobs, from the most basic of keys to the more sophisticated transponder-based models. Each model has its own unique features and requirements for programming that will impact the total cost of the service. Certain keys might also require specialized programming that is not accessible to the general public. This may require a visit from an agent.
Many people assume that they can save money by changing the key fob's programming themselves, and in some cases this is true. Certain fobs, depending on the model, can be programmed online, or following the instructions in the owner's manual of the vehicle. This does away with the need to visit a dealer. This is not the case for certain fobs such as ones that are built into the vehicle key or require an FOBIK chip.
A few large retailers of auto parts such as AutoZone and others, do sell replacement remotes with instructions on how to program them. However, this is not the case for all automobiles, since they have to be linked to the vehicle's computer using special equipment to ensure that the device functions properly. This process can be risky since any error could cause a reversal of the information on the fob's key. It's best to let the work to professionals.
Auto Locksmiths
Modern automobiles come with keyfob remotes, which can unlock and lock doors, arm and disarm alarm systems and even start the engine. They are convenient, but they can also cause problems. If the key fob of a car is damaged or has lost its battery, repairing the device can be expensive. Installing a new device could be difficult and requires an expert to program it correctly. Luckily auto locksmith key programming locksmiths are able to offer car key fob programming near me at a fraction of the cost of the dealer.
A locksmith who is a professional and provides a replacement car key cut And programed key fob service may possess specialized tools that be used with all types of vehicles. Some professionals can also reprogram an old key fob or keyless entry remote for another vehicle. However it's not always possible and it is dependent on the year, model and model of the vehicle.
Contacting a locksmith prior to visiting a dealership to repair your car key fob is always advisable. Locksmiths will usually provide a superior service than dealerships and cost less. A professional locksmith has the tools and knowledge necessary to install the key fob and program it into your vehicle. They also offer a guarantee on their work.
Certain manufacturers prohibit dealers from selling or programming aftermarket keyfobs. The aftermarket devices have an entirely different encryption method than the original equipment keyfob, which could cause problems with your car's safety system. Some dealers told us they would program key fobs from aftermarket dealers when the owner knew the dangers.
A professional locksmith uses the transponder tool programmable to program a key fob. This tool can detect the unique serial number and other information on your car's key fob. Then, it will match the data to the correct key code in your car's computer system.

Whether your car is new or old key fobs are vulnerable to hacking attempts. Criminals use specialized devices that amplify signals to trick your vehicle and its key fob into thinking that they are closer than they are. This could cause the key fob to unlock or start your engine, which could result in theft. You can buy gadgets such as faraday bags to block these signals.
